随着软件项目越来越复杂,传统的手动测试已经无法满足质量需求和时间效率。因此,自动化测试成为了越来越多项目的必要选择。
自动化测试是指通过编写脚本或使用工具,将测试用例自动运行、自动执行和自动检查结果,以提高测试效率、降低测试成本和人为误差。这种方法比传统的手动测试更为准确、快捷、方便和可靠。
自动化测试应用场景广泛,主要包括以下几个方面:
1.回归测试:在软件开发周期内,每次迭代后都需要进行一遍回归测试来保证之前的功能不会被破坏。如果使用手动测试,会浪费大量时间和人力资源。而自动化测试可以轻松地进行回归测试,从而节省时间和减少错误率。
2.性能测试:自动化测试可以模拟大量并发用户对系统发起请求,然后收集和分析系统的性能数据,以检验系统是否可以很好地满足业务需求。这对于一些对系统响应速度有极高要求的网站或者应用非常重要。
3.接口测试:自动化测试可以验证接口的正确性、可用性和可靠性。这样可以在开发人员修改代码时发现问题,从而更快修复。
4.安全测试:自动化测试可以模拟黑客公鸡,检测系统是否存在安全漏洞和隐患。这对于一些需要高安全性的项目来说非常必要。
总之,自动化测试是一种非常有用的工具,它可以帮助开发团队更好地管理和控制软件质量,提高项目效率和可靠性。虽然自动化测试需要一定的投资,但从长远来看,它将会带来更多的收益和价值。
以上内容为大家介绍了自动化测试怎么用?自动化测试应用场景,希望对大家有所帮助,如果想要了解更多接口自动化测试相关知识,请搜索关注多测师。
标签:场景,可以,手动,接口,测试,自动化 From: https://blog.51cto.com/u_16144988/6416851